The Importance of Green Infrastructure in Achieving Sustainable Cooling

The increasing global temperatures and the rise of urbanization have brought about the need for sustainable cooling solutions in urban areas. Traditional cooling technologies, such as air conditioning units, contribute to greenhouse gas emissions and energy consumption, exacerbating the effects of climate change. Green infrastructure offers an environmentally friendly and sustainable approach to cooling urban areas. By incorporating natural elements into the built environment, green infrastructure can provide numerous benefits in terms of cooling, energy efficiency, and overall well-being.

1. Cooling Effect of Green Infrastructure

Green infrastructure, including trees, green roofs, and vertical gardens, can help mitigate the urban heat island effect. The urban heat island effect occurs when urban areas experience higher temperatures than surrounding rural areas due to the excessive heat absorbed and emitted by buildings and pavement. Trees and vegetation provide shade and evaporative cooling, reducing ambient temperatures and creating a more comfortable microclimate. Additionally, green roofs and vertical gardens help insulate buildings, reducing the need for air conditioning and lowering energy consumption.

2. Energy Efficiency and Cost Savings

Green infrastructure can significantly contribute to energy efficiency and cost savings in cooling urban areas. By reducing the urban heat island effect, green infrastructure decreases the demand for air conditioning and other cooling systems. This leads to lower energy consumption and cost savings for both individuals and municipalities. 3. Improved Air Quality and Health Benefits

Green infrastructure plays a vital role in improving air quality in urban areas. Trees and plants help filter pollutants from the air, reducing the presence of harmful substances and improving overall air quality. By removing pollutants, green infrastructure contributes to better respiratory health and reduces the risk of respiratory diseases. The presence of green spaces also promotes physical activity and mental well-being, leading to a healthier and happier population.

4. Climate Change Mitigation

Green infrastructure plays a crucial role in mitigating climate change. By incorporating green spaces into urban areas, the carbon footprint can be reduced significantly. Trees and vegetation absorb carbon dioxide, a greenhouse gas responsible for climate change, and release oxygen, improving air quality and reducing the overall carbon emissions. Green infrastructure also helps regulate water runoff, preventing flooding and protecting urban areas from the impacts of extreme weather events caused by climate change.
